How much do customer support analyst j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for customer support analyst in the United States is $27.92,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.43 and $39.66 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does a Customer Support Analyst Do?

A customer support analyst collects and analyzes customer data and then works to develop resolutions for issues. Job duties include communicating with customers through phone and email, executing research strategies to improve productivity and customer satisfaction, and promptly following up with customer requests. In this job, you use surveys, reports, and other techniques to troubleshoot issues, and you may train new employees. This career requires customer service and communication skills, and many employees prefer experience in sales, marketing, or customer service. Qualifications typically include a bachelor’s degree or a combination of training and education. Some companies may also require in-house training that’s industry-specific.

What is a Customer Support Analyst?

A Customer Support Analyst is a professional who assists customers by resolving their technical or service-related issues, often acting as the first point of contact for support inquiries. They analyze customer problems, provide solutions, and escalate complex issues to higher-level support teams if necessary. Their primary goal is to ensure customer satisfaction by delivering timely and effective assistance, collecting feedback, and often helping to improve support processes. Customer Support Analysts work across various industries, including technology, finance, and retail.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Customer Support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Customer Support Analyst, you need strong problem-solving abilities, knowledge of customer service principles, and usually a bachelor's deg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with CRM software (like Salesforce or Zendesk), ticketing systems, and basic troubleshooting tools is typically required. Excellent communication, patience, and active listening are standout soft skills for this role. These skills and qualities are crucial for efficiently resolving customer issues, ensuring satisfaction, and maintaining positive company reputation.

How does a Customer Support Analyst typically collaborate with other departments to resolve customer issues?

Customer Support Analysts frequently work with teams such as Product Development, Engineering, and Sales to address complex customer problems. When an issue requires technical expertise or product changes, analysts escalate cases and provide detailed feedback to these departments, ensuring accurate and prompt solutions. This collaboration not only helps resolve individual cases but also contributes to identifying and fixing recurring issues, improving the overall customer experience. Regular communication and interdepartmental meetings are common to keep everyone aligned and informed.

Position: Customer Support Analyst 

Location: Kennesaw, Georgia 30144

Duration: 3 Month Contract to Hire


We have 4 open three month contract to hire IT Customer Support Analyst positions for our direct client in Kennesaw GA. The ideal candidates would be local and have the following experience:

  • Strong call center experience
  • SQL 
  • Retail technical support
  • Strong technical skills
  • Active Directory
  • Service Now
  • Excellent multi-tasker (will have 5 or 6 systems working at once)
  • Excellent troubleshooting skills


Duties

  • Answer Inbound ACD Calls:
  • Answer ACD calls within duration specified within the KPI (key performance indicator) for average wait time (AWT)
  • Address all ACD calls within a duration specified within the KPI (key performance indicator) for average handle time (AHT)
  • Maintain individual call abandon rate that is at least 2% below the departmental goal for abandon rate (ABD)
  • Inbound E-mail support (All Non-Critical Issue Types)
  • Respond to inbound e-mails from customers to the NSC within parameters defined NSC management
  • Inbound Chat Support (All Non-Critical Issue Types)
  • Respond to chats from customers to the NSC within parameters defined by NSC management
